In memoriam


The following sites and services have stated that the Online Safety Act 2023 is the reason for their closing, or for geo-blocking UK users. - AWScommunity.social, a Mastodon instance for discussing AWS technologies, with approximately 300 users (epitaph) - Charlbury in the Cotswolds has (as of 2025-02-19) shut its debate forum (epitaph) - Espruino's forum, a forum for discussing embedded computing (epitaph) - furry.energy, a small (49 user) UK based Mastodon Server oriented towards those in the furry & LGBTQA+ communities (epitaph likely to go missing, as I can't add it archive.org) - Gaming on Linux, a discussion forum about the operating system Linux and computer games (epitaph) - The Green Living Forum, a discussion board running since 2006, with just under 500,000 posts about sustainable living (epitaph) - Haiku (an open source operating system inspired by BeOS)'s discussion forum (epitaph)They've hopefully found a workable solution! - Hexus, a computing gaming and general discussion forum, with approximately 310,000 registered users (epitaph) - LFGSS (London Fixed Gear and Single-Speed), a cycling forum (epitaph) - Lobste.rs, a tech discussion forum (epitaph) - Microcosm, a forum-hosting service, reported as having about 275,000 monthly average users, mostly from the UK (epitaph) - Ready To Go, a discussion forum about Sunderland AFC, a football club (epitaph).
